Output c15f89ba243a05be59029ddb8d8e69b2c2ec1883dcb0a891fb1baa74eaeb65ba:4

value
709112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24a0ea80aa29296f54ee85be67bae6dcb79b4702 OP_EQUAL
address
352h26Ep2a1mFqe9qaLPQkqfmaCvBN2ZsG
transaction
c15f89ba243a05be59029ddb8d8e69b2c2ec1883dcb0a891fb1baa74eaeb65ba
confirmations
261456
spent
true